Hello everyone
 
 
 
This problem came across when I was modelling an ice-storage system. Hourly report said the charge and discharge load are both zero, which means the tank doesn’t work under the setting condition. The supposed entering temperature of the tank is -6℃ and is leaving at -3℃. Freeze temp is below -10℃. In order to run the simulation, I have to raise the charge/discharge temperature as well as the loop temperature of charge loop up above 0℃. When the charge temperature is above or  equal to zero, the tank does work. However it changes the performance of double duty chillers under ice-making mode, since the curve of chiller is different with different leaving temperature, leading to a bigger assigned load of double duty chiller than the max charge load and less accurate results.
 
 
 
Does anyone have any thoughts how to solve this problem? Making storage tank work below 0℃ at setting temperature? Or is this the limit of eQuest software yet to be solved?
